The cheapest way to get from Orlando Health/Amtrak to Disney Springs is to drive which costs $3 - $5 and takes 21 min.
The fastest way to get from Orlando Health/Amtrak to Disney Springs is to taxi which takes 21 min and costs $45 - $55.
No, there is no direct bus from Orlando Health/Amtrak to Disney Springs. However, there are services departing from N Garland Ave & W Amelia St and arriving at E Buena Vista Dr & Bonnet Creek Pkwy via . The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 59 min.
The distance between Orlando Health/Amtrak and Disney Springs is 20 miles. The road distance is 16.3 miles.
The best way to get from Orlando Health/Amtrak to Disney Springs without a car is to line 300 bus which takes 59 min and costs $3 - $5.
It takes approximately 59 min to get from Orlando Health/Amtrak to Disney Springs, including transfers.
Orlando Health/Amtrak to Disney Springs bus services, operated by Lynx Central Florida Transport, depart from N Garland Ave & W Amelia St station.
Orlando Health/Amtrak to Disney Springs bus services, operated by Lynx Central Florida Transport, arrive at E Buena Vista Dr & Bonnet Creek Pkwy station.
Yes, the driving distance between Orlando Health/Amtrak to Disney Springs is 16 miles. It takes approximately 21 min to drive from Orlando Health/Amtrak to Disney Springs.

What companies run services between Orlando Health/Amtrak, FL, USA and Disney Springs, FL, USA?
Lynx Central Florida Transport operates a bus from N Garland Ave & W Amelia St to E Buena Vista Dr & Bonnet Creek Pkwy every 30 minutes. Tickets cost $2 and the journey takes 28 min.
